NVIDIA Corporation
Queue manager for streaming multiprocessor systems
Last updated:
Abstract:
A queue manager apparatus converts inbound commands of a first width into scalar format commands to be queued in a command queue. Furthermore, the queue manager converts the scalar format commands residing in the command queue into outbound commands of a second width for transmission. Converting inbound commands to scalar format commands and then converting the scalar format commands to a target width for transmission allows the queue manager to advantageously provide efficient and programmable command transmission between arbitrary processing units, regardless of potentially mismatched native command widths.
Status:
Grant
Type:
Utility
Filling date:
9 Nov 2017
Issue date:
26 Nov 2019